| /** | ||
| * A class that can be used to calculate the usages of ILM policies. This class computes some information on initialization, which will | ||
| * use a bit more memory but speeds up the usage calculation significantly. | ||
| */ | ||
| public class LifecyclePolicyUsageCalculator { | ||
|
|
||
| private final ClusterState state; | ||
| /** Whether {@link #calculateUsage} will be called multiple times or not. */ | ||
| private final boolean willIterate; | ||
| /** A map from policy name to list of data streams that use that policy. */ | ||
| private final Map<String, List<String>> policyToDataStream; | ||
| /** A map from composable template name to the policy name it uses (or null) */ | ||
| private final Map<String, String> templateToPolicy; | ||
